SARGODHA: The Drug Rehabilitation Centre at District Headquarters (DHQ) teaching hospital provided treatment facilities to 40 drug addicts, the Drug Committee was told on Friday. The capacity of 12-bed centres would be doubled due to increasing number of patients, deputy commissioner said while chairing a meeting of the drug committee. The meeting was told that in March 2018, 714 people were arrested over their involvement in drug-related crimes and 686 cases were registered. He said the PC-1 of Drug Rehabilitation Centre, New Satellite Town had been approved and its construction would start in next financial year.
